Poor Credit Score
One of the most common reasons for personal loan India rejection is a poor credit score. Lenders use credit scores to determine the creditworthiness of a borrower. A low credit score indicates that the borrower has a history of late payments, defaults, or high credit utilization. If your credit score is below the lender’s threshold, they may reject your application.
Insufficient Income
Lenders also consider your income when evaluating your loan application. If your income is insufficient to cover your existing debts and the new loan payments, the lender may reject your application. You should ensure that your debt-to-income ratio is within the lender’s acceptable range.
Unstable Employment History
Lenders look for borrowers who have a stable employment history. If you have a history of changing jobs frequently or have gaps in your employment, the lender may view you as a risky borrower and reject your application.
Incomplete Application or Missing Documentation
Another common reason for personal loan rejection is an incomplete application or missing documentation. You should ensure that you provide all the required information and documents accurately and completely. Any mistakes or omissions can cause delays or rejections.
Multiple Loan Applications
Applying for multiple loans at the same time can also hurt your chances of getting approved. Each time you apply for a loan, it triggers a hard inquiry on your credit report, which can lower your credit score. Moreover, lenders may view you as desperate for credit, and this can affect your chances of approval.
